Flathead Lake Brewing Co. Pubhouse (Bigfork, MT): This brewery combines award-winning beers with stunning views of Flathead Lake. They focus on sustainability and use local ingredients, making their brews a true taste of Montana

​

Draught Works Brewery (Missoula, MT): This brewery is celebrated for its innovative beers and welcoming atmosphere. Their GABF award-winning beers are a testament to their quality.

​

KettleHouse Brewing Co. (Missoula, MT): Known for their iconic Cold Smoke Scotch Ale, KettleHouse has been a staple in Montana's craft beer scene for years. They focus on sustainability and community engagement.

​

Philipsburg Brewing Company (Philipsburg, MT): Located in a historic building, this brewery offers a mix of classic and creative beers, all brewed with Montana-grown ingredients.

​

Blackfoot River Brewing Company (Helena, MT): A community-focused brewery with a strong lineup of ales, Blackfoot River Brewing is a favorite among locals and visitors alike.

​

Lewis & Clark Brewing Company (Helena, MT): With a spacious taproom and a variety of award-winning beers, this brewery is a must-visit for craft beer enthusiasts.

​

Highlander Beer (Missoula, MT): With a rich history dating back to 1910, Highlander Beer combines tradition with modern brewing techniques to create exceptional craft beers.
